Mr. Projectile - Bioluminescence

Audio clip: Adobe Flash Player (version 9 or above) is required to play this audio clip. Download the latest version here. You also need to have JavaScript enabled in your browser.

Minnesota native and nomad raver Matthew Arnold, aka Mr. Projectile, has been spotted in recent years wandering the California coastline with a Nord Modular G2 on his back.  After his 2004 album Sinking left a permanent impression on Staylucid’s collective brain, we’ve been following closely behind to hear what would follow.  Last month Projectile finally emerged with a new album, To The West, on his own Semisexual label.  The record is a chronicle of where he’s been over the last few years, and a pure beam of expression from the man who recently said he had “moved into a blue castle in the redwoods, developed superpowers, and directly experienced timelessness.”

SLIDECAMP - FULL HINGE

Slidecamp is the duo of Ryan Gilbert (who records as Comma) and Boreta (of The Glitch Mob).  As they quietly prepare their full-length debut, we present this track, which is one of the first they ever did together.  Due to their rare appearances and few releases, a petition was recently circulated online stating that the act of withholding their debut is “psychologically reckless.”  This should help ease the wait.

San Francisco’s friendly purple button pusher EPROM has docked at our portal for a moment to deliver a symbol of goodwill.  The gift he brings is his remix of The Earlies “Breaking Point.” Click the image above (which EPROM also designed!) to download.

EPROM’s “Zoning” 12″ with Profisee was just released on Cloak x Dagger, while his split 12″ on Warp Records with the homie Eskmo is due imminently.  If those don’t melt your turntable, his murky single Humanoid is set to drop soon on Amsterdam’s blazing Rwina label.
